Brief Season Prediction

I will keep this pretty short. I think Penn State has a good team, but not on the level of the 08 or 05 team. The strengths are obvious: Best returning QB and RB in the Big Ten on offense. Best linebackers in the Big Ten on defense, and solid defensive line. The question marks are also obvious: No experience on OL, WR, or in the secondary.

The area where Penn State truly benefits this year is their schedule. The Big Ten is the worst as I have ever seen it right now, the overall schedule is not very difficult. On top of that, PSU's two toughest opponents are both at home (Iowa and OSU). Most likely both will be night games, which only gives PSU an even greater advantage. As a result of this schedule, Penn State has a legitamite shot to run the table this year. They may be favored in each of there games all season. With that being said, I expect them to lose one game this year. I think they will beat Ohio State and Iowa at home at night, but they will find a way to drop a game to someone like Northwestern or Minnesota. Just my two cents.
